Epigenetics Market Size
The global epigenetics market size was valued at $2.14 billion in 2024 and is projected to reach $6.08 billion by 2030, growing at a CAGR of 19.0% during the forecast period.

Epigenetics Market Overview
Epigenetics is the study of changes in gene expression or cellular phenotype that do not involve alterations in the underlying DNA sequence. This field explores how environmental factors, such as diet, stress, and exposure to toxins, can influence the way genes are turned on or off, without changing the genetic code itself. These changes are often mediated by chemical modifications to DNA or histone proteins, which can affect how tightly or loosely DNA is wound around histones, thereby controlling access to the genetic information. Epigenetic modifications can be heritable, passed down from one generation to the next, yet they are also reversible, allowing organisms to adapt to changing environments. This dynamic interplay between genetics and environment helps explain variations in traits and diseases that cannot be attributed solely to genetic mutations.

Epigenetics Market Dynamics
• The epigenetics market is expected to witness significant growth in the future due to increasing prevalence of cancer and chronic diseases, advances in epigenetic research and technology, and growing investment in biotechnology and pharmaceutical sectors.
• Additionally, the rising demand for personalized medicine, expanding applications of epigenetics in drug discovery and development, and increasing collaboration between academic institutions and biotech companies are the prominent factors driving the growth of the market.
• However, the high cost of epigenetic research and therapies, limited awareness and understanding of epigenetics, and ethical and regulatory challenges are restraining the market growth.
• On the contrary, the expansion into emerging markets, advances in next-generation sequencing and bioinformatics tools, and growing focus on early detection and prevention of diseases through epigenetic biomarkers are creating opportunities for market growth.
  
By End User, the Pharmaceutical and Biotechnology Segment Constitutes Immense Share with Epigenetics Market
The pharmaceutical and biotechnology segment holds a significant share within the epigenetics market owing to its transformational potential for understanding and treating complicated disorders. Epigenetics, which studies heritable changes in gene expression without changing the underlying DNA sequence, provides fundamental insights into the processes of diseases such as cancer, neurological disorders, and autoimmune ailments. This improved understanding allows for the creation of novel therapies that can precisely target epigenetic changes, resulting in more effective and tailored treatments. Additionally, the advancements in epigenetic research tools and technologies have increased drug discovery and development processes, making it a crucial area of focus for pharmaceutical and biotechnology companies. The growing recognition of the role of epigenetic mechanisms in disease etiology and progression, coupled with the promise of innovative therapeutic interventions, underscores the significant demand for epigenetics in these industries.

By Geography, North America is Projected to Show Strong Presence in the Epigenetics Market
North America is anticipated to show a robust presence during the forecast period due to the substantial investments in R&D, a strong presence of key market players, and a highly developed healthcare infrastructure. In the United States, the epigenetics industry benefits from significant federal funding and private investments. Canada's epigenetics market, though smaller than the US, is experiencing rapid growth due to increased research activities and government support. Organizations such as the Canadian Institutes of Health Research (CIHR) provide substantial funding for genetic and epigenetic studies. Canadian researchers actively participate in international collaborations, contributing significantly to advancements in the field. The Canadian healthcare system, known for its focus on accessibility and quality, increasingly incorporates epigenetic insights into clinical practice, particularly in oncology and chronic disease management. The biotech sector in Canada is also expanding, with numerous startups and established companies investing in epigenetic research and development.
• According to the US Department of Health and Human Services, over 129 million people in the US suffer from at least one chronic disease. Additionally, 42% of Americans have two or more chronic conditions, while 12% have at least five.

Recent Developments:
• In March 2024, PacBio introduced the PureTarget repeat expansion panel, a groundbreaking solution for the comprehensive analysis of 20 genes linked to serious neurological disorders, including those with challenging tandem repeat expansions. This new long-read workflow streamlines the process by minimizing the need for iterative analysis using legacy technology, significantly reducing the time required to identify disease-causing variants and associated methylation signatures.
